UK at 'Bama game on CBS
      TUSCALOOSA, Ala. The Alabama-Kentucky game will be televised by CBS. The Oct. 4 game at Bryant- Denny Stadium will kick off at 3:30 p.m. EDT. The two teams haven't met since the Crimson Tide's 45-17 win in 2004. Other Southeastern Conference games to be televised that weekend include Florida at Arkansas and Auburn at Vanderbilt.

Greg Biffle leaves heads turning
      Greg Biffle's start in the Chase has to have the rest of the field shaking their heads wondering if the Roush Fenway driver will cool off anytime soon. After going winless in the 26 races leading up to the Chase, Biffle has now visited victory lane in the first two races of the 10-race playoff.
